Getting Started

Getting Started

Congratulations on your purchase of a ViewSonic® LCD Display®. Important! Save the original box and all packing material for future shipping needs.

NOTE: The word “Windows” in this user guide refers to the following

Microsoft operating systems: Windows ‘95, Windows NT, Windows ‘98, Windows 2000, Windows Me (Millennium), and Windows XP.

Package Contents

LCD display

VGA cable

AC/DC power adapter

Power cords

Audio cable (for speakers)

ViewSonic Wizard CD-ROM

NOTE: The CD jacket contains the Quick Start Guide, and the CD includes the User Guide PDF files and INF/ICM display optimization files. The INF file ensures compatibility with Windows operating systems, and the ICM file (Image Color Matching) ensures accurate on-screen colors. ViewSonic recommends that you install both files

Precautions

Sit at least 18" from your LCD display.

Avoid touching the screen. Skin oils are difficult to remove.

Never remove the rear cover. Your LCD display contains high-voltage parts. You may be seriously injured if you touch them.

Avoid exposing your LCD display to direct sunlight or another heat source. Orient your LCD display away from direct sunlight to reduce glare.

Always handle your LCD display with care when moving it.

Place your LCD display in a well-ventilated area. Do not place anything on your LCD display that prevents heat dissipation.

Ensure the area around the LCD display is clean and free of moisture.

Do not place heavy objects on the LCD display, video cable, or power cord.

If smoke, abnormal noise, or strange odor is present, immediately switch the LCD display off and call your dealer or ViewSonic. It is dangerous to continue using the LCD display.
